rtc: rework rtc_register_device() resource management

rtc_register_device() is a managed interface but it doesn't use devres
by itself - instead it marks an rtc_device as "registered" and the devres
callback for devm_rtc_allocate_device() takes care of resource release.

This doesn't correspond with the design behind devres where managed
structures should not be aware of being managed. The correct solution
here is to register a separate devres callback for unregistering the
device.

While at it: rename rtc_register_device() to devm_rtc_register_device()
and add it to the list of managed interfaces in devres.rst. This way we
can avoid any potential confusion of driver developers who may expect
there to exist a corresponding unregister function.

drivers/rtc/test: Update driver to address y2038/y2106 issues

This driver has a number of y2038/y2106 issues.

This patch resolves them by:

- Replacing get_seconds() with ktime_get_real_seconds()
- Replacing rtc_time_to_tm() with rtc_time64_to_tm()

Also add test_rtc_set_mmss64() for testing rtc_class_ops's
set_mmss64(), which can be activated by "test_mmss64" module
parameter.
